first, singing too high in chest voice isn't the only way to hurt your throat. your sore throat might be illness or misuse or both. as far as 'spin' is concerned, a lack of spin does not come from using chest voice (after all, us low voiced males like to have some spin on our low notes). the lack of spin comes from not allowing your folds to vibrate optimally. most likely, you are pressing your breath on the high notes. this either causes a breathy sound with much reduced volume or causes your larynx to seize up causing a strangled sound. both have no spin.
